Nice mod 19!
Keep in mind, shoot only 158 grainers out of it,
The 125s can do some damage to that fine Smith shooting iron!
You can shoot 38 specials till the cows come home, as well as 357 158 grain.
The light stuff can crack the forcing cone,
I have a 19 that looks just like yours!
